International Trade
& Investment Law

In an era of globalisation and cross-border business, understanding the rules of international trade and investment is vital. At Xuba & Associates Attorneys Inc., we provide strategic legal services to businesses, investors, and institutions navigating the complex frameworks governing international commerce, treaties, and cross-border transactions.

Our firm advises on international trade agreements, bilateral investment treaties (BITs), trade remedies, export controls, and customs regulations. We assist clients in complying with international trade obligations, resolving disputes involving international trade rules, and structuring cross-border investments to minimise risk and enhance protection under applicable treaties.

We act for both foreign and domestic clients engaging in international ventures—whether investing into or out of South Africa. Our services include:

  • Drafting and negotiating international commercial contracts

  • Advising on trade sanctions and compliance with global regulations (e.g., WTO law, SACU, SADC)

  • Structuring foreign direct investments (FDIs) and joint ventures

  • Navigating investor-state dispute settlement (ISDS) mechanisms

  • Representing clients in investment arbitration under international rules (ICSID, UNCITRAL, etc.)
